Restaurant City hints

  • When you start out, save your money for ingredients so you can level up your Restaurant City recipes. Higher level recipes help you get more gourmet points (experience points).
  • You can’t get more money per dish, but you can serve more dishes and faster. Focus on your restaurant layout to do this.
  • Nice looking furniture can help you get your restaurant rated faster, but it doesnt actually increase your Restaurant City Popularity rating in the game.
  • Each day you get a free ingredient and can take the food quiz. These are updated everyday at midnight GMT, which is 8 p.m. eastern standard time.
  • Ingredient prices at the market vary daily, but generally anything less than $3,000 is considered a good deal.
  • A good restaurant city tip is that ingredients offered at the market are random, so make sure to stock up on the ones you need when you have the chance.
  • Make friends in the game, and visit their restaurant at least once to get your free ingredient for visiting them.
  • Dress your employees up in uniforms so that it is easy to remember who and how many people are chefs, waiters, and janitors.
